The Strait of Hormuz sits between Iran's southern coast and the Omani exclave of Musandam. Roughly 21 million barrels of crude move through it daily, plus a quarter of the planet's liquefied natural gas. Iran has spent decades building a military posture calibrated for one job: making an unescorted transit through that corridor feel unacceptable. The arsenal is asymmetric โ Noor and Qader anti-ship missiles, M-08 mines, swarming fast-attack craft, Shahed-136 loitering munitions, and a small submarine force. Revolutionary Guard forward bases along the northern Gulf and near Qeshm Island sit close enough for shore-based batteries to cover the entire shipping lane. None of this wins a fleet-on-fleet fight against the U.S. Fifth Fleet in Bahrain. It doesn't need to win. It needs to inflict enough chaos that the market prices risk into every barrel. Analysts call this chokepoint hostage-taking.
The diplomatic context matters more than the military one. Saudi Arabia and Iran restored formal relations in 2023, with Beijing as the broker. Yet Riyadh, Abu Dhabi and Manama stood with Washington in refusing the toll. Economic detente has a boundary, and it runs through the water that carries their exports. Those states host the region's most aggressive Web3 experiments: Dubai's VARA licensing regime, Bahrain's crypto-asset approvals, Saudi Arabia's Vision 2030 spending. The toll dispute will not stay confined to diplomatic cables. It alters insurance, invoicing and settlement of energy cargoes โ the real economy underneath those digital-asset hubs.
The fee demand itself is deceptively simple. Tehran framed the proposal as a cost of security: vessels transiting Hormuz would pay for the safety of the route, the way a port charges docking fees. The framing matters. A blockade is an act of war. A fee is a service. By choosing the word 'fee,' Iran converts a military threat into a revenue proposal, and a revenue proposal is negotiable. That single semantic move shifts the conversation from deterrence to contract โ which is precisely where Iran wants it. It puts Washington in the position of explaining why paying for security is unacceptable rather than why a blockade will be met with force.

An unenforceable fee is an empty function call. Iran can declare the toll tomorrow, but collection requires physical inspection, flag-state compliance and a settlement mechanism counterparties accept. Tankers sail under flags of convenience; cargo ownership is layered through dozens of charterers; and payments move through dollar correspondent systems that Tehran cannot access. A fee without enforcement is a threat with a null return value. The Houthi precedent in the Red Sea illustrates the alternative: enforcement against shipping works only while you are willing to shoot, and shooting brings a coalition response. Iran understands this. That is why the demand is framed as a fee rather than a blockade. A blockade invites a military response; a fee invites a negotiation. Coercion designed to sit one step below armed conflict.
This is where markets repriced risk in ways most crypto commentary misses. After the Red Sea attacks of 2024, war-risk premiums on eastern corridor shipments spiked sharply, and some cargoes rerouted around the Cape of Good Hope, adding ten to fourteen days of transit. Those changes were already priced into freight indexes. A Hormuz fee dispute enters at a different point: it affects the Persian Gulf, the single densest node of global energy settlement. If insurers begin attaching chokepoint clauses to Gulf cargoes, the effective fee lands on every invoice before Iran collects a cent. The market taxes the route preemptively. There is a deeper structural reason the toll cannot work as a protocol upgrade. International maritime law treats transit passage through a strait as a right, not a privilege. The 1982 UN Convention on the Law of the Sea guarantees ships the right of transit passage through straits used for international navigation โ including Hormuz, even though Iran never ratified it. A toll regime would require rewriting that legal invariant, and rewrites of fundamental invariants are where systems break. The second blind spot is the unity of the Gulf rejection. A three-of-five multisig is not a unanimous vote. Oman and Qatar maintain working diplomatic channels with Tehran and have historically resisted escalation. The joint statement reflects the signers on paper, but the abstentions matter for settlement modeling. Treating the Gulf as a single security actor will misprice corridor risk.
